What Constitutes a Personal Injury Case?
Injury law covers a wide array of scenarios where an person's physical or psychological well-being has been injured due to someone else’s negligence or intentional act. In Phoenix, these cases often include vehicle collisions, slip and falls, healthcare malpractice, and injuries at work. For instance, if you are involved in a vehicle accident or sustain an injury due to unsafe conditions at a business in central Phoenix or even in nearby areas such as Glendale or the Tempe region, you may have grounds for a personal injury claim.
A personal injury case is not restricted to bodily injuries. Psychological trauma resulting from negligence can also qualify, emphasizing the need to evaluate each case on its individual merits. Whether the injury occurs in a vibrant city like Phoenix or a more peaceful suburb like Tolleson, the circumstances surrounding the incident are crucial for determining the strength of your case.
Lawsuits of this nature require a comprehensive inquiry to determine liability and assess damages. Proof such as eyewitness testimonies, medical reports, and crash site photos is often collected to substantiate a claim. This thorough method ensures that all aspects of the incident are meticulously examined to help formulate a robust compensation claim.

Statute of Limitations for Filing Claims
The statute of limitations is an essential component of personal injury law that determines the period during which a lawsuit can be filed. In Phoenix and surrounding regions like Tempe and Glendale, strict deadlines are enforced to ensure claims are made while evidence is still fresh. Typically, the time limit for filing a personal injury claim in Arizona is two years from the date of the injury.
If you miss this deadline, you might lose the chance to seek compensation altogether, regardless of the strength of your case. That's why it is crucial to seek legal advice as soon as possible after an accident. By consulting with a personal injury attorney promptly, you can ensure that all pertinent evidence is maintained and that your case is filed within the required timeframe.
Additionally, exceptions to these time limits exist in select cases, such as cases involving minors or cases where the injury was not instantly detected. Grasping these nuances can alter the outcome in determining whether you can proceed with your claim.
